Curveball
Photo by Mark Duffel on Unsplash

life is teaching you a lesson

are you getting the answer or asking the question?

it's hard to tell which way is up, but it's not to tell where I messed up

I never was too good in school, I slacked off and I broke the rules

I never got the hang of anything I was supposed to

life is throwing you a curveball

do you step up to the plate, do you swing at all?

it's hard to tell what I should do, it's harder to tell what I shouldn't do

I never was too much for words, no point in talking if you're never heard

I never got the hang of anything I was supposed to

life is handing you a lemon

do you make lemonade, or sit asking questions?

it's hard to tell what I should say, it's harder to tell if I'm okay

well, that curveball is coming straight for the plate

are you gonna swing at all, or just gonna stand there and wait?
